Output 0313907e9d3fecb1b754da10955c10ca033c332aeab4bdfcd64a9e7a42257123:19

value
19622752
script pubkey
OP_0 OP_PUSHBYTES_20 301802c6c7a79ad587d66e7045d56e56d34d83d4
address
ltc1qxqvq93k857ddtp7kdecyt4tw2mf5mq75qzghwt
transaction
0313907e9d3fecb1b754da10955c10ca033c332aeab4bdfcd64a9e7a42257123
spent
true